About This Episode  Many investors default to a single broad index fund, often the S&P 500, because it’s simple and low-cost. In this episode, Glen and Robert discuss how that approach can work for certain types of investors and when it may not align with specific objectives or risk profiles.   They also dive into ETFs vs. mutual funds, explore diversification across asset classes and regions, explain bond mechanics and duration, and walk through tax-loss harvesting and mutual fund capital-gain distributions in practical, plai...
